A common pattern in I/O programming is to do things like this: But this is not possible in Scala because... .. returns Unit, not the new value of bytesRead. Seems like an interesting thing to leave out of a functional language.
I am wondering why it was done so? I advocated for having assignments return the value assigned rather than unit.
